Jens Baier
Leader of HR topic at BCG in Europe and Middle East
Professional Background
Jens Baier stands out as a notable figure in the consulting industry, particularly as the Managing Director and Senior Partner at The Boston Consulting Group (BCG), where he leads HR initiatives across Europe and the Middle East. With a career at BCG that dates back to 2000, Jens has built a reputation for managing a diverse array of projects. His extensive expertise covers areas such as Human Resource (HR) excellence programs, the migration of HR IT systems to cloud solutions, effective strategy development, large-scale transformations, and organizational redesigns. In addition, he has been instrumental in defining the role of centralized organizations, setting up and optimizing shared services, and implementing cost efficiency programs. His extensive experience spans multiple industries, allowing him to serve a wide range of clients in Germany, Europe, the Middle East, and even South Africa.
Notably, Jens has contributed significantly to the field of human resources through his insightful publications. His articles have been featured in esteemed platforms, including the Harvard Business Review, showcasing topics such as strategic workforce planning and the adoption of cloud-based HR IT solutions. Education and Achievements
Jens Baier's academic journey lays a strong foundation for his remarkable career. He holds a Master's degree in Business Administration from the Wissenschaftliche Hochschule (WHU) in Coblenz, Germany, where he gained crucial insights that have fueled his passion for strategic consulting. Additionally, Jens broadened his educational experience by studying at the University of Michigan in Ann Arbor, USA, and the Ecole Supérieure de Commerce de Reims in France. This diverse educational background not only solidified his understanding of international business practices but also equipped him with the skills necessary to navigate the complexities of global human resource challenges.
Before embarking on his university education, Jens completed an apprenticeship as an industrial manager (Industriekaufmann) at Deutag AG in Duisburg, Germany. This early training offered him invaluable insights into the operational aspects of businesses, further enhancing his strategic approach to consulting and organizational development.
In addition to his extensive educational background, Jens serves as the honorary CEO of Joblinge gAG Ruhr, an organization dedicated to supporting adolescents and immigrants in securing apprenticeships and reducing unemployment rates.
